NVIDIA RTX 6000 Ada

Technical Specifications

VRAM 48 GB GDDR6 ECC
Memory Bandwidth 960 GB/s
FP16 Performance 686.1 TFLOPS
FP32 Performance 91.1 TFLOPS
TDP 300W
Form Factor PCIe Gen4 Dual-Slot
PCIe Interface PCIe Gen4 x16
Max GPUs per Server Up to 4 (workstation) / Up to 8 (server)

Best For

3D rendering and ray tracing (Blender, V-Ray, Redshift, Arnold)
CAD/CAM/BIM visualization (SolidWorks, Revit, CATIA)
AI-assisted design and content creation
Professional workstations requiring ECC memory and ISV certification

Not Ideal For

  • Pure LLM training (H100/A100 offer better training throughput)
  • Dense inference deployments (L4 is more power/space efficient)

Overview

The NVIDIA RTX 6000 Ada Generation is the flagship professional GPU for workstations and rendering servers. It combines 48 GB of ECC GDDR6 memory with Ada Lovelace architecture, delivering both professional visualization and AI capabilities in a single card.

For VFX and 3D rendering, the RTX 6000 Ada features third-generation RT cores that deliver up to 2x the ray tracing performance of the previous-generation RTX A6000. It is certified by all major ISVs including Autodesk, Dassault, PTC, and Siemens, ensuring stability in production environments.
